Meaning & usage

noun
  1. kerchief, neckerchief, coif, wimple, shawl

    feminine · masculine
  2. handkerchief

    feminine · masculine
  3. apron

    feminine · masculine
Where this word comes from

Borrowed from Old French volet.

noun
  1. poem of praise

    obsolete
Where this word comes from

Inherited from Middle Welsh molet. By surface analysis, mawl (“praise”) + -ed.
